Fast Forward New Mexico is pleased to offer information regarding online educational resources available to New Mexicans through various institutions and public libraries around the state, as well as important information on Broadband availability and digital inclusion. Broadband and Digital Inclusion
The latest Federal Communications Commission's annual Broadband progress report concludes that "too many Americans remain unable to fully participate in our economy and society because they lack broadband." Click here to see the full report.
